Local car repair services will often use ramps for this process. Anyway, the old steering damper should be near the passenger side coil spring. If you see a cotter pin holding the old stabilizer from one side, you can take the cotter pin out with a pair of wire cutters.
Usually, an 18 mm bolt supports the stabilizer from the other side. You can ease it out with a wrench. If it's being particularly stubborn, try tapping its head with a hammer. Be gentle; otherwise, you might damage the threading. You can use the same mounting bracket with a little modification.
If the new steering damper is of a different size, you'll be provided with a template in the box. Once you do that, the holes on the mounting bracket will align with the holes on the left shock. Drive the stock bolt through the first hole and the new bolt through the second hole.
Fasten them tightly and move on to the next step! The other shock has pre-drilled holes for installing bolts from the front and nuts from the back. It gets pretty straightforward from this stage. The shock should be facing up as you secure the washer and the nut one by one. You need to torque it down ft. Now that you have both the left and right shocks in place, all there's left to do is finally install the spirit damper. The new stabilizer will have spacers on both ends.

Why: I have always vibration problems with my Jeep, and my steering seemed sloppy, so after much procrastination, I decided to do something about it. What exactly is a Steering Stabilizer? One end is mounted to a fixed point like the axle and the other end is connected to your tie rod. When you drive, the wheels will move left and right, and if your ride's like mine, they'll vibrate too.
The steering stabilizer simple absorbs some of the shock, and gives your steering a move tight feel. The install: This is a pretty simple upgrade, simply unbolt and remove the existing steering stabilizer, then install the new one using the included hardware.
The new stabilizer didn't mount the same way as the old one, one end linked the the axle, and the other to the tie rod the original mounted to the tie rod on one end, and to a special mount point on the other.
